Transaction 87dfbf157b5350078e592512efa77f44f5dc411f217b4b2fe59f3250b2ec7071

1 Input
2 Outputs
  • 87dfbf157b5350078e592512efa77f44f5dc411f217b4b2fe59f3250b2ec7071:0
  • value  100130
    address  1E5WXcpVbmqsDfadeddmPsix54GsXTuHGk
  • 87dfbf157b5350078e592512efa77f44f5dc411f217b4b2fe59f3250b2ec7071:1
  • value  611619130
    address  3KHWrMo8EnzCh6uhXrozHUhBtogqiWpux4